Perhaps the biggest advantage of hiring regulatory consulting experts is their extensive knowledge of both international and domestic laws. These professionals assist clients in preparing documentation and reports related to the regulatory process for Investigational Device Exemption (IDE) applications, 510(k) submissions, and Premarket Approval (PMA) applications. They also assist clients in meeting regulatory criteria for technical reports and clinical evaluation reports. By collaborating with regulatory consultants, medical device companies are able to reduce their administrative burden and concentrate on the creative aspects of their business.
Additionally, medical device regulatory consulting services provide risk mitigation and management services. Regulatory consultants analyze the area in which clients may be at risk in the area of compliance and plan how to reduce or eliminate risk. They develop plans for post-market surveillance, adverse event reporting, and compliance audits of the updated quality management system. By addressing different regulatory issues, the manufacturers and the consultants provide solutions to related problems in the area of patient’s safety, brand reputation, and costly regulatory consequences.
Lastly, regulatory strategy planning is one of the most important traits of these types of consulting services. The consultants analyze the global market and set the objectives for each set of market entry requirements and tailored regulatory strategy. A medical device company targeting the simultaneous entry of the U.S. and European markets, for example, would be advised on how to align submission requirements and pursue concurrent submission and approval for both jurisdictions. This regulatory strategy enables the company to optimize its time and investment, thereby achieving the best possible return.
